长光华芯:激光能量传输芯片及激光电池相关技术将主要用于特定场景下的无线能量传输探索
Zheng Quan Ri Bao· 2026-02-25 12:42
Core Viewpoint - Changguang Huaxin is focusing on the development of laser energy transmission chips and laser battery technologies for specific applications in wireless energy transmission, particularly in cutting-edge areas like space power supply [2] Group 1: Technology Development - The laser energy transmission chip and related technologies are still in the early stages of industrial development [2] - The project is currently in a continuous research and development phase, with plans to gradually form commercial products [2] - The company will keep an eye on the pace of commercial application deployment and will promote the iteration of related products and technologies [2]
长光华芯:公司100mW CW DFB芯片产品已达到量产出货水平,在等待订单状态
Zheng Quan Ri Bao Wang· 2026-02-05 13:43
Group 1 - The company Changguang Huaxin is currently validating its 200mW CWDFB communication chip and 200G PAM4 EML communication chip [1] - The laser energy transmission chip is under development [1] - The company's 100mW CWDFB chip product has reached mass production and is currently in a waiting order status [1]
